Bake the Best of It - WordPress Site Hosted On AWS

Frontend

Backend

AWS Services Used

Dev Tools

Full Site: Bake the Best of It

Overview

This is a WordPress blog built for the user to share their favorite recipes. The project is built using WordPress and hosted on AWS using Elastic Beanstalk, RDS, S3, and EFS. The project uses a custom theme and plugins to provide a seamless experience for user. The project also uses AWS services like CloudWatch, SNS, SES, CloudFormation, CloudFront, and Route53 to provide a reliable and scalable infrastructure for the WordPress site.

Features

  • Custom WordPress Theme and Plugins: The project uses a custom WordPress theme and plugins to provide a unique and user-friendly interface for the blog. The theme is designed to showcase the recipes in an attractive and easy-to-navigate layout, and the plugins provide advanced features like recipe search, categorization, and social sharing.

  • AWS Elastic Beanstalk for WordPress Hosting: The project is hosted on AWS using Elastic Beanstalk, which provides a scalable and reliable infrastructure for the WordPress site. The project uses a custom environment configuration to optimize the performance and cost of the hosting.

  • AWS RDS for MySQL: The project uses AWS RDS for MySQL to provide a managed database service for the WordPress site. The RDS instance is configured for high availability and automatic backups to ensure the reliability and security of the data.

  • AWS EFS for WordPress File Storage: The project uses AWS EFS for WordPress file storage to provide a scalable and reliable file system for the WordPress site. The EFS file system is configured for automatic backups and lifecycle management to optimize the cost and performance of the file storage.

  • AWS SES for WPMail: The project uses AWS SES which is integrated through a custom built plugin to provide a reliable and scalable email service for the WordPress site. The SES service is configured for high deliverability and automatic bounce handling to ensure the reliability and security of the email communication.